Transaction 888888d63e578f323cf93f5c5d7b31edb498542ae9268dfad91afde195de9404
1 Input
1 Output
-
888888d63e578f323cf93f5c5d7b31edb498542ae9268dfad91afde195de9404:0
- value
- 13578
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0843ed99267a3b7412c7c5d8cc34e0a2b73949b48416964b881f24ce570cbbc6
- address
- bc1pppp7mxfx0gahgyk8chvvcd8q52mnjjd5sstfvjugrujvu4cvh0rq9yzpt6